SEDCAD+ INPUT PARAMETERS COMMON TO ONE <br />OR MORE AREAS <br />3.1 Rainfall Depth <br />The rainfall depth fora 10-year, 24-hour storm event waz determined to be 1.90 inches; the rainfall depth fora 100- <br />yeaz, 24-hour storm even[ was determined to be 2.8 inches [National Oceanic and Atmospheric Administration <br />(NOAA) Atlas 2, Precipitation -Frequency Atlaz of the Western United States, Volume III -Colorado, & Previous <br />Reports]. <br />3.2 Land Use Condition (LUC) <br />LUC values are consistently applied az follows (reference SEDCAD+ guide): <br />For undisturbed portions of the watershed, overland flow: 2 (woodland). <br />For fill slopes, overland flow: 5 (nearly bare). <br />For other than overland flow and for ditch flow: 7. <br />4.
